Potts Kick Into Action for Sunshine Fund
The sun has come out for the second year running for Cramlington based printing firm Potts who have helped raise nearly £31, 500 for North East children’s charity the Evening Chronicle Sunshine Fund at their Celebrity Question of Sport event.
Potts were the headline supporter for the for the Sunshine Fund Celebrity Question of Sport event along with ITPS, which this year was held at the Marriott Gosforth Park Hotel. The money that was raised will go towards buying special equipment for sick and disabled children in the North East.
Mark Devine, Commercial Director at Potts said: "We have shown our support to the Sunshine fund for a second year because we believe it is such a fantastic charity that helps so many disabled children in the North East, we had a great night at the Question of Sport event last year so this encouraged us to support the cause again."

The ’Question of Sport Quiz’ ran throughout the night with various sporting themed prizes on offer for the winning tables. There were also special raffle and auction prizes and to complete the hat-trick every table if requested had its own sporting celebrity guest.
Potts began as a family run business more than 130 years ago in North Shields, and is now one of the most progressive UK print companies. It has recently moved premises to Cramlington as part of a £4m investment which has increased its capabilities in both the commercial print sector and growing demand from the packaging markets.
